HackerEarth Partners with Lever to Boost Speed and Efficiency of Tech Hiring Process

HackerEarth

HackerEarth, a leading solutions provider for remote developer assessments, interviews, and upskilling, today announced its newest of many Applicant Tracking System (ATS) integrations with Lever, a leading Talent Acquisition Suite. As a part of HackerEarth’s network of ATS integrations, existing Lever users will be able to easily access and optimize use of HackerEarth Assessments.

HackerEarth’s integration with Lever allows recruiters to manage the applicant screening workflow faster and more efficiently. The key benefits of the integration for users include:

  • Lever users can directly send HackerEarth Assessments invites to their candidates at various stages of the job hiring lifecycle. Once the candidate completes the assessment, their score, and a report containing performance data are linked back into Lever.
  • Lever users can eliminate the constant shifting between LeverTRM and HackerEarth’s platform and view all hiring data from one dashboard. Recruiters can screen candidates faster using HackerEarth, while all members of the hiring team can stay abreast of the progress, by viewing it on the Lever Dashboard.
  • Hiring managers have all candidate information easily accessible on demand, and recruiters can provide candidates with real-time feedback.
  • Lever users have the option to send more than one assessment to evaluate a particular candidate. If the recruiter or hiring manager chooses to retest the candidate (on a different level of assessment or skill set), the integration allows that.
